Tom Gjelten Reports On The Meeting Between The 43 Countries

involved in implementing the Bosnian peace agreement. Today and tomorrow, the group will meet in Florence, Italy to review the progress of the implementation. NATO troops did put an end to the fighting, but other elements of the agreement are behind schedule. At issue now is whether to proceed with elections scheduled for September.
